Will Bratt to race Rob Austin Audi at Oulton Park

The 24-year-old will drive the second Audi for the squad while team boss Rob Austin will sit out the meeting while his car continues to be repaired following his accident at Thruxton and mechanical dramas at Donington.
The team issued a statement saying: “Rob Austin will sit out this round due to damage sustained at Thruxton and a lack of parts.”
In the past, Bratt has raced in Formula Renault UK and recently challenged for the Formula 2 championship title, and will make his debut in the car Chris Swanick made his BTCC debut with for the 2011 final round at Silverstone.
In the team’s statement they also praised Bratt, and expect him to display the true pace of the Audi which they believe “has not yet been seen this season”.
Bratt has already successfully tested the Audi at Rockingham and impressed with his pace as he converts from single seater racing, Austin himself saying that he expects Bratt will be competitive and hopes a stronger relationship can be formed for him within the team should the weekend be successful.
Austin is however still hoping to return to the series at the next round at Croft on June 23/24, the team statement added. “Whilst we are sad not to have Rob out as well, he is still searching for sponsorship and we expect to have a pair of Audis out at Croft.”
